Section 305 – Registration of order.

78B-7-305. Registration of order. Any individual may register a foreign protection order in this state under Section 78B-7-116. Renumbered and Amended by Chapter 3, 2008 General Session

Section 307 – Other remedies.

78B-7-307. Other remedies. A protected individual who pursues remedies under this part is not precluded from pursuing other legal or equitable remedies against the respondent. Renumbered and Amended by Chapter 3, 2008 General Session

Section 308 – Uniformity of application and construction.

78B-7-308. Uniformity of application and construction. In applying and construing this uniform act, consideration must be given to the need to promote uniformity of the law with respect to its subject matter among states that enact it. Renumbered and Amended by Chapter 3, 2008 General Session
